Costs

When estimating the cost of replacing windows, homeowners must consider the materials and styles of their windows. Other factors can also affect the cost, such as whether they would like windows that are energy efficient, special window treatments and more. The more customizations that homeowners want to make, the higher the cost.

Homeowners can cut down on their window replacement costs by opting for retrofit installations, which uses the existing frame and trim instead of replacing them. However, this option isn't recommended for older homes or those that have significant damage to frames and trim. To get an accurate estimate homeowners should talk to an expert in the area of window repair.

The decision to purchase new windows is a significant purchase for a homeowner Many are worried about the cost of installation. A professional window installer will assist them in understanding their options and help them make the best choice for their budget. They can, for example, explain the difference between single- and double-paned glass windows. Single-paned windows let sunlight in through the window, but prevent heat from escaping during winter. Double-paned windows, on the contrary, prevent air leaks and cut down on cooling and heating costs by up to 40 percent.

The type of frame you choose will also impact the cost of the project. Aluminum frames can run from $75 to $400 for a window. Wood is more expensive, but more durable than aluminum. Vinyl frames are cheap and easy to maintain, however they don't insulate well. Composite frames, which combine wood fibers with polymers to give the strength of wood, without the need for maintenance they require, are among the most durable and energy efficient options at $700-$1,200 per window.

Financing

Window replacement is a significant project However, there are a number of financing options that can make it more affordable. Some contractors offer their own financing programs and others may collaborate with lenders to provide an array of financing options. These programs can assist homeowners in paying for the cost of replacing their windows without draining their family savings account or taking out the home equity loan.

One method to make your new windows more affordable is to opt for an installment plan with a fixed monthly payment. This can make it simpler to budget for the price of your windows and will also give you the peace of mind knowing that your monthly payments will be the same each month. Furthermore, newer windows are more energy efficient, which can lead to lower utility bills.

Another alternative is to take advantage of federal, state and local incentives that may assist you in reducing the cost of your new windows. These incentives are available through Property Assessed Clean Energy Programs or other incentive programs for energy efficiency programmes. In some cases, the cost of your new window can be deducted from your income taxes.

You might also consider applying for personal loans to pay for the cost of installing new windows. This kind of loan is designed for homeowners who require financing for costly home improvement projects and renovations. Many lenders allow homeowners to prequalify for loans within minutes, without affecting their credit score.

Installation

A professional window replacement company can assist you in choosing windows that will complement your home and fit your budget. They can also assist with the installation. They will remove the old window and clean the work area. They can also install doors that are replacement, and also replace the screens and trim. These services are available for new construction projects and retrofits.

Windows last an average of 20-30 years. They should provide insulation and protection from extreme temperatures. In time, they'll begin to deteriorate, and their functionality may be reduced. This could lead to drafts and hefty energy costs. You should think about replacing your windows when they show signs of wear or are not effective in reducing noise and energy costs.

A window repair and replacement company should also be insured. This will protect you if there are any damages during the installation process. They should provide a guarantee for their products and their labor. A window installer will be able to explain the procedure of installing new windows and provide you with a detailed schedule and timeline. They should also explain the various types of windows and materials to ensure that you can choose the most appropriate one for your home.

During the consultation process, a knowledgeable and experienced contractor will be available to answer any questions you might have. They will also give you an estimate of the cost and prepare a quote. They will help you decide whether you'd prefer a full-frame window replacement or a retrofit installation. A full-frame replacement will involve taking out the entire frame and sash. On the other hand, retrofit installations only replace the sash.

The Right to Rent

If homeowners decide to upgrade their windows, they desire the security that comes from knowing that their investment is secure. Finding a window replacement company near me that provides an industry-leading warranty is a way to make the process more simple. A quality window warranty will cover products, parts, labor, and installation. It must also be transferable to the next homeowner.

The type of window warranty that is provided can differ greatly, and it is important to know what the terms of each offer. Warranty categories include limited lifetime, prorated and double life. A limited lifetime warranty could be a good option for homeowners. However, it's difficult to know what exactly the coverage will cover.

It is crucial to be aware of the history of the company and what warranty coverage it offers. A company with a long history of experience is a great option, as it is more likely to remain around in the future to handle any issues that may arise.

It is also important to determine whether the warranty covers labor costs and whether the company is insured. This will help you in the event that someone is injured during the installation of the product. It will also save you money in the event that an employee damages the product.
